Anyways, I think the Empire would not have held. Palpatine had power as he had been, at one point, an elected official and was in general favor with the public at the time of transition from Republic to Empire. Anakin was a war hero himself, but... not quite the same public standing. He'd be taking power by force and people wouldn't like that...
After saving Padme, what point would there be to stay evil? If he could somehow control himself and turn back to the LS, then it would be a peaceful, benevolent Empire... unlikely though
